Back to Trapout number 1. I visited the trapout when it just got dark to see exactly how many bees I had in there. What I saw from underneath the five (screen bottom board) was six frames completely convered with bees, plus a few more on frames 7,8 and 9. All in, probably 6.5 frames if they were all shoved together.
What I also noticed was that there was a big pile of bees clustered together at the entrance to the trapout box. Not hanging in a beard below the entrance, but piled up and across most of the screen bottom board entrance. Never have I seen that before, it was as if they were not allowed inside even though there was plenty of room for them. The trapout box is a 10-frame deep hive body. Any ideas what is going on?
